Smelling of Tulips, Inc., a perfume company, estimated its short-run costs using a U-shaped average variable cost function of the formand obtained the following results.Total fixed cost (TFC) at S.T. Inc. is $1,250.

Adjusted R Square

0.758

C SE Tstat p-val

Intercept 32.52 2.33 13.95 0.0008

Q -1.39 0.51 -2.72 0.0146

Q^2 0.10 0.02 4.23 0.0006

What level of output (Q) is associated with the minimum AVC? What is the value of AVC at this minimum?

b.Determine equations for ATC, TC, and MC. Graph one scatterplot of Q vs. TC, and another scatterplot of Q vs. ATC, AVC, and MC.

c.When output is 9, how much is TC, AVC, ATC, and MC?

d.At what amount of output does labor change from exhibiting increasing returns to decreasing returns?
